1. Set realistic goals: Begin by setting achievable goals that align with your lifestyle and physical abilities. Whether it’s losing a few pounds, running a marathon, or simply incorporating regular exercise into your routine, remember to set specific and measurable goals. Breaking down larger goals into smaller, manageable steps can make the journey less overwhelming.
2. Make fitness a habit: Regular physical activity is not just a one-time event; it should become a part of your daily routine. Schedule time for exercise, just like you would for other important commitments. Whether it’s waking up early for a morning jog, joining a fitness class after work, or taking a brisk walk during your lunch break, find an activity that suits you and stick to it.
3. Find a workout buddy: Exercising with a friend or joining a group fitness class can make your fitness journey more enjoyable and motivational. Having someone to share your progress, challenges, and triumphs with can keep you accountable and provide extra encouragement when needed.
4. Incorporate variety: Don’t limit yourself to just one form of exercise. Incorporate a variety of physical activities into your routine to challenge different muscle groups and avoid boredom. Try mixing cardio exercises like running, swimming, or cycling with strength training, flexibility workouts like yoga or Pilates, and high-intensity interval training (HIIT) for a well-rounded fitness regimen.
5. Listen to your body: While it’s essential to push yourself to reach your fitness goals, it is equally important to listen to your body’s signals. Pay attention to any pain, discomfort, or fatigue that may arise during exercise. Take rest days when needed and modify your workouts to suit your current energy levels. Remember, fitness is a lifelong journey, and listening to your body will help prevent injuries and burnout.
6. Prioritize nutrition: Regular exercise should go hand in hand with a nutritious and well-balanced diet. Fuel your body with wholesome foods that provide essential nutrients, vitamins, and minerals. Incorporate plenty of f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, whole grains, and healthy fats into your meals. Stay hydrated by drinking enough water throughout the day and reduce your consumption of sugary drinks and processed foods.
7. Embrace an active lifestyle: In addition to structured workouts, find ways to be active throughout the day. Take the stairs instead of the elevator, go for a walk during breaks, or engage in fun activities like dancing, swimming, or gardening. Every little movement counts towards a healthier and more active lifestyle.
8. Stay consistent and be patient: Results may not come overnight, but staying consistent and patient is key. Celebrate small victories along the way, and remember that your fitness journey is unique to you. Focus on progress rather than perfection, and most importantly, enjoy the process.
